I am not sure about my daughters sebright eggs. I took a video of them. This is day 18. There is lots of light shining through and the air sac is really huge and it moves away from the inner shell lining. ALL 7 seven eggs look the same with the exception of not all have the air sac that moves. The video isn't the best but I woud like opinions on if you think they may have stopped developing. Are you seeing any movement? Air sacs that move when you turn the egg| could

be caused by improper storing and handling. The air sac being so large means humidity

is lower than what it should be.

The humidity is at 61% right now. It was at 50ish until today. Our book says to increase on day 18. The egg looks about only 1/3 full. Lots of light. I don't think I see movement. But then I think I do when I turn the egg in my hand. Could that be just the inerds moving from turing it. ANy others eggs we have candled at this stage have been practically dark with the exception of the air sac. So weird.
